iTITLE: Note on one class of self-similar motions of a relaxing gas
SOURCE: *Zhurnal vychislitel'noy matematiki i matematicheskoy fiziki, v. 6, no. 6,
1966, 1119-1127
TOPIC TAGS: hypersonic aerodynamics, similarity theory, relaxing gas, unsteady flow,
hypersonic flow
ABSTRACT: One-dimensional self-similar motion of a relaxing gas displaced by a
piston according to an exponential law Us = Uoekt is considered. Gasdynamic param-
eters of the flow field between the piston and shock wave are calculated from a sys-
tem of ordinary differential equations describing one-dimensional, unsteady flows of
relaxing gas which allows a certain class of self-similar solutions under certain.
assumptions. The applicability of the results obtained to investigation of hyper-
sonic relaxing gas flows past slender sharp-nosed bodies is considered by using
the hypersonic equivalence principle. Orig. art. has: 6 figures. CAB]

ABSTRACT: Developed by the Institute of Automatics and Telemechanics, AN SSSR,
and tested by the Grozny Branch of the VNIIKAneftegas, a new telemetry system is
described which: (a) uses a frequency band as narrow as 12 cps, (b) gendi3 signalf;
over a 6/0.4-kv electric-power distribution network, (c) uses no 280-cps carrier
isolating choke coils, and (d) employs transmitters of only 1-3-w capacity. The
signal transducer at the sending end and the pulse-time signal selector at the
receiving end are based on a special bridge-type semiconductor exponential
-converter. The transmitter generates two pulses: a sync pulse and a parameter
Card 1/2
ACC NRt AT6011829 C
pulse. The sync pulse triggers a pulse generator at the receiving end; the paramete:
pulse stops this generator; the number of counted -pulses represents the measurand.,
The counter controls either a digital display device or an electric printer. Block
diagrams and some principal circuits are shown. Preliminary tests have shown a
basic system error (less transmitter) of 1 0. 51%. Orig. art. has: 12 figurea and
I I formula@.

This Author Certificate presents a pulse selector containing an RC ladder
network. The device selects Dulses with a width larger than a specified value and
fixes pulses with delayed fronts. It contains a four-arm bridge of resistors and
,capacitors (see Fig. 1). One diagonal of the bridge holds an emitter-base junction
of the transistor. The base of the transistor is connected with the cathode of a
diode. The atode of the diode is connected to the mid-point of a resistance divider
included in the input.of the selector.
